Compare commits
15 Commits
| Author | SHA1 | Date | |
|---|---|---|---|
|
|
16a467056b | ||
|
|
052f5e8474 | ||
|
|
3801c64e7f | ||
|
|
29153ba787 | ||
|
|
4ddfe13cd7 | ||
|
|
2f9bed3b97 | ||
|
|
1886674cff | ||
|
|
e3b4dc923c | ||
|
|
cf52435176 | ||
|
|
7a8476ea67 | ||
|
|
24e77083e8 | ||
|
|
efb721c9de | ||
|
|
5bc48aaa13 | ||
|
|
2133a48667 | ||
|
|
2486615249 |
@ -1,6 +1,6 @@
|
||||
--- !Policy
|
||||
product_versions:
|
||||
- rhel-10
|
||||
- rhel-9
|
||||
decision_context: osci_compose_gate
|
||||
rules:
|
||||
- !PassingTestCaseRule {test_case_name: baseos-ci.brew-build.tier1.functional}
|
||||
|
||||
@ -172,7 +172,7 @@ BuildRequires: gcc-toolset-%{gts_ver}-devel
|
||||
Summary: GCC version %{gcc_major}
|
||||
Name: %{?scl_prefix}gcc
|
||||
Version: %{gcc_version}
|
||||
Release: %{gcc_release}.6%{?dist}
|
||||
Release: %{gcc_release}.5%{?dist}
|
||||
# License notes for some of the less obvious ones:
|
||||
# gcc/doc/cppinternals.texi: Linux-man-pages-copyleft-2-para
|
||||
# isl: MIT, BSD-2-Clause
|
||||
@ -2902,26 +2902,21 @@ fi
|
||||
%endif
|
||||
|
||||
%changelog
|
||||
* Tue Sep 9 2025 Siddhesh Poyarekar <siddhesh@redhat.com> 15.1.1-2.6
|
||||
- Fix glibc32 build dependency (RHEL-113183)
|
||||
* Tue Sep 9 2025 Siddhesh Poyarekar <siddhesh@redhat.com> 15.1.1-2.5
|
||||
- Fix glibc32 build dependency (RHEL-113182)
|
||||
|
||||
* Wed Jul 30 2025 Siddhesh Poyarekar <siddhesh@redhat.com> 15.1.1-2.5
|
||||
- Drop the workaround for CVE-2025-5702 (RHEL-100161)
|
||||
* Mon Jun 16 2025 Marek Polacek <polacek@redhat.com> 15.1.1-2.4
|
||||
- ship libstdc++.modules.json (RHEL-97095)
|
||||
|
||||
* Fri Jun 20 2025 Siddhesh Poyarekar <siddhesh@redhat.com> 15.1.1-2.4
|
||||
- Require gcc-toolset-N-runtime (RHEL-94672)
|
||||
|
||||
* Mon Jun 16 2025 Marek Polacek <polacek@redhat.com> 15.1.1-2.3
|
||||
- ship libstdc++.modules.json (RHEL-97043)
|
||||
- configure with --with-long-double-format=ieee (RHEL-97055)
|
||||
|
||||
* Thu Jun 12 2025 Siddhesh Poyarekar <siddhesh@redhat.com> 15.1.1-2.2
|
||||
- Tune for z16 on s390x by default on RHEL10 and later (RHEL-94282)
|
||||
* Thu Jun 12 2025 Siddhesh Poyarekar <siddhesh@redhat.com> 15.1.1-2.3
|
||||
- Add AS_NEEDED libstdc++.so.6 when only needed through libstdc++_nonshared
|
||||
(RHEL-84680)
|
||||
(RHEL-94866)
|
||||
|
||||
* Fri Jun 6 2025 Marek Polacek <polacek@redhat.com> 15.1.1-2.1
|
||||
- configure with --enable-host-pie --enable-host-bind-now (RHEL-95595)
|
||||
* Fri Jun 6 2025 Marek Polacek <polacek@redhat.com> 15.1.1-2.2
|
||||
- configure with --enable-host-pie --enable-host-bind-now (RHEL-95564)
|
||||
|
||||
* Wed Jun 4 2025 Marek Polacek <polacek@redhat.com> 15.1.1-2.1
|
||||
- re-enable annobin-plugin and offload-nvptx
|
||||
|
||||
* Wed May 21 2025 Marek Polacek <polacek@redhat.com> 15.1.1-2
|
||||
- update from releases/gcc-15 branch
|
||||
|
||||
@ -8744,7 +8744,7 @@
|
||||
+//asm (".hidden _ZNKSt10filesystem4_Dir7currentEv");
|
||||
--- libstdc++-v3/src/nonshared17/Makefile.am.jj 2025-05-06 15:48:48.687747618 +0200
|
||||
+++ libstdc++-v3/src/nonshared17/Makefile.am 2025-05-06 16:10:20.603262671 +0200
|
||||
@@ -0,0 +1,174 @@
|
||||
@@ -0,0 +1,155 @@
|
||||
+## Makefile for the C++17 sources of the GNU C++ Standard library.
|
||||
+##
|
||||
+## Copyright (C) 1997-2025 Free Software Foundation, Inc.
|
||||
@ -8839,25 +8839,6 @@
|
||||
+libnonshared17convenience110_la_SOURCES = $(sources110) $(inst_sources110)
|
||||
+libnonshared17convenience140_la_SOURCES = $(sources140) $(inst_sources140)
|
||||
+
|
||||
+if GLIBCXX_LDBL_ALT128_COMPAT
|
||||
+floating_from_chars.lo: floating_from_chars.cc
|
||||
+ $(LTCXXCOMPILE) -mabi=ibmlongdouble $(LONG_DOUBLE_128_FLAGS) -c $<
|
||||
+floating_from_chars.o: floating_from_chars.cc
|
||||
+ $(CXXCOMPILE) -mabi=ibmlongdouble $(LONG_DOUBLE_128_FLAGS) -c $<
|
||||
+floating_to_chars.lo: floating_to_chars.cc
|
||||
+ $(LTCXXCOMPILE) -mabi=ibmlongdouble $(LONG_DOUBLE_128_FLAGS) -c $<
|
||||
+floating_to_chars.o: floating_to_chars.cc
|
||||
+ $(CXXCOMPILE) -mabi=ibmlongdouble $(LONG_DOUBLE_128_FLAGS) -c $<
|
||||
+floating_from_chars110.lo: floating_from_chars110.cc
|
||||
+ $(LTCXXCOMPILE) -mabi=ibmlongdouble $(LONG_DOUBLE_128_FLAGS) -c $<
|
||||
+floating_from_chars110.o: floating_from_chars110.cc
|
||||
+ $(CXXCOMPILE) -mabi=ibmlongdouble $(LONG_DOUBLE_128_FLAGS) -c $<
|
||||
+floating_to_chars110.lo: floating_to_chars110.cc
|
||||
+ $(LTCXXCOMPILE) -mabi=ibmlongdouble $(LONG_DOUBLE_128_FLAGS) -c $<
|
||||
+floating_to_chars110.o: floating_to_chars110.cc
|
||||
+ $(CXXCOMPILE) -mabi=ibmlongdouble $(LONG_DOUBLE_128_FLAGS) -c $<
|
||||
+endif
|
||||
+
|
||||
+# AM_CXXFLAGS needs to be in each subdirectory so that it can be
|
||||
+# modified in a per-library or per-sub-library way. Need to manually
|
||||
+# set this option because CONFIG_CXXFLAGS has to be after
|
||||
@ -8947,7 +8928,7 @@
|
||||
+#include "../c++17/cow-string-inst.cc"
|
||||
--- libstdc++-v3/src/nonshared17/Makefile.in.jj 2025-05-06 15:48:48.688747604 +0200
|
||||
+++ libstdc++-v3/src/nonshared17/Makefile.in 2025-05-07 10:09:21.643442963 +0200
|
||||
@@ -0,0 +1,871 @@
|
||||
@@ -0,0 +1,854 @@
|
||||
+# Makefile.in generated by automake 1.15.1 from Makefile.am.
|
||||
+# @configure_input@
|
||||
+
|
||||
@ -9799,23 +9780,6 @@
|
||||
+
|
||||
+vpath % $(top_srcdir)/src/nonshared17
|
||||
+
|
||||
+@GLIBCXX_LDBL_ALT128_COMPAT_TRUE@floating_from_chars.lo: floating_from_chars.cc
|
||||
+@GLIBCXX_LDBL_ALT128_COMPAT_TRUE@ $(LTCXXCOMPILE) -mabi=ibmlongdouble $(LONG_DOUBLE_128_FLAGS) -c $<
|
||||
+@GLIBCXX_LDBL_ALT128_COMPAT_TRUE@floating_from_chars.o: floating_from_chars.cc
|
||||
+@GLIBCXX_LDBL_ALT128_COMPAT_TRUE@ $(CXXCOMPILE) -mabi=ibmlongdouble $(LONG_DOUBLE_128_FLAGS) -c $<
|
||||
+@GLIBCXX_LDBL_ALT128_COMPAT_TRUE@floating_to_chars.lo: floating_to_chars.cc
|
||||
+@GLIBCXX_LDBL_ALT128_COMPAT_TRUE@ $(LTCXXCOMPILE) -mabi=ibmlongdouble $(LONG_DOUBLE_128_FLAGS) -c $<
|
||||
+@GLIBCXX_LDBL_ALT128_COMPAT_TRUE@floating_to_chars.o: floating_to_chars.cc
|
||||
+@GLIBCXX_LDBL_ALT128_COMPAT_TRUE@ $(CXXCOMPILE) -mabi=ibmlongdouble $(LONG_DOUBLE_128_FLAGS) -c $<
|
||||
+@GLIBCXX_LDBL_ALT128_COMPAT_TRUE@floating_from_chars110.lo: floating_from_chars110.cc
|
||||
+@GLIBCXX_LDBL_ALT128_COMPAT_TRUE@ $(LTCXXCOMPILE) -mabi=ibmlongdouble $(LONG_DOUBLE_128_FLAGS) -c $<
|
||||
+@GLIBCXX_LDBL_ALT128_COMPAT_TRUE@floating_from_chars110.o: floating_from_chars110.cc
|
||||
+@GLIBCXX_LDBL_ALT128_COMPAT_TRUE@ $(CXXCOMPILE) -mabi=ibmlongdouble $(LONG_DOUBLE_128_FLAGS) -c $<
|
||||
+@GLIBCXX_LDBL_ALT128_COMPAT_TRUE@floating_to_chars110.lo: floating_to_chars110.cc
|
||||
+@GLIBCXX_LDBL_ALT128_COMPAT_TRUE@ $(LTCXXCOMPILE) -mabi=ibmlongdouble $(LONG_DOUBLE_128_FLAGS) -c $<
|
||||
+@GLIBCXX_LDBL_ALT128_COMPAT_TRUE@floating_to_chars110.o: floating_to_chars110.cc
|
||||
+@GLIBCXX_LDBL_ALT128_COMPAT_TRUE@ $(CXXCOMPILE) -mabi=ibmlongdouble $(LONG_DOUBLE_128_FLAGS) -c $<
|
||||
+
|
||||
+# Tell versions [3.59,3.63) of GNU make to not export all variables.
|
||||
+# Otherwise a system limit (for SysV at least) may be exceeded.
|
||||
+.NOEXPORT:
|
||||
|
||||
@ -9,9 +9,10 @@
|
||||
---
|
||||
summary: Tier 0 test plan
|
||||
context:
|
||||
component: gcc-toolset-15-gcc
|
||||
collection: gcc-toolset-15
|
||||
environment+:
|
||||
WITH_SCL: gcc-toolset-15-env
|
||||
COLLECTIONS: gcc-toolset-15
|
||||
WITH_SCL: "scl enable gcc-toolset-15"
|
||||
discover:
|
||||
- name: collect_info
|
||||
how: shell
|
||||
|
||||
Loading…
Reference in New Issue
Block a user